When Blowing Rock Needs Gas Line Integrity & Safety Repairs
Homeowners in Blowing Rock often wait too long on these issues. Catch them early.
- Rotten egg or sulfur odor indoors
- Hissing sound near gas appliances
- Dead vegetation over buried gas lines
